SBW was delisted on the 16th of December, 2016.

33 hedge funds and large institutions have $30.8M invested in Western Asset Worldwide Income in 2014 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 4 funds opening new positions, 12 increasing their positions, 10 reducing their positions, and 4 closing their positions.
